WebApr 3, 2024 · For a large room, use 6-8-10 or 9-−12–15 feet (−3.7–4.6 m) or meters. [1] 3 Measure four units along the other side. Using the same unit, measure along the second side, at – hopefully – a 90º angle to the first. Mark this point at four units. [2] 4 Measure the distance between your marks. If the distance is 5 units, your corner is square. [3]

When you’ve recorded this measurement, hold your tape measure in the next corner and measure across the diagonal to its opposite corner.
